pg_meta_dataGet meta data for table Description
array pg_meta_data
( resource
$connection
, string $table_name
)pg_meta_data returns table definition for table_name as an array. Warning
This function is EXPERIMENTAL. The behaviour of this function, its name, and surrounding documentation may change without notice in a future release of PHP. This function should be used at your own risk. Parameters
